The Rise Of Enterprise Marketplace: Transforming The Way Businesses Operate

In today’s fast-paced business environment, organizations are constantly looking for innovative solutions to streamline their operations and drive efficiency. One such solution that has gained immense popularity in recent years is the Enterprise Marketplace. This concept is revolutionizing the way businesses operate by providing a centralized platform where companies can buy and sell products and services internally.

Enterprise Marketplace allows organizations to create their own e-commerce platform within the company, which enables employees to easily procure goods and services from approved suppliers. This can include anything from office supplies and software to marketing services and consulting. By centralizing the procurement process, businesses can save time, reduce costs, and improve transparency.

One of the key benefits of Enterprise Marketplace is the ability to easily manage and track purchases. By utilizing a centralized platform, companies can streamline the procurement process, automate approval workflows, and generate detailed reports on spending. This not only helps organizations make more informed purchasing decisions but also ensures compliance with company policies and regulations.

Another advantage of Enterprise Marketplace is the increased visibility and control over spending. By providing employees with a curated list of approved suppliers and products, companies can better manage their budgets and prevent unauthorized purchases. This level of transparency also allows organizations to negotiate better pricing with suppliers and track the performance of vendors over time.
